2019 marks the final year of an
ambitious three-year Strategic Plan
‘Creating, Thinking and Doing for
today and tomorrow’. This annual
report presents both a demanding
and rewarding period of success
and transformation on KU’s journey,
delivering the Strategic Plan 2017-
2019. The Strategic Plan had five key
objectives: engaged stakeholders;
a sustainable, scalable business
model; social policy and investment;
achieving excellence; and producing
knowledge with specific targets for
each of these objectives.
